The Rev. John GLUBB, B.A.
Set As Default Person -
Name John GLUBB Prefix The Rev. Suffix [ONS gp] B.A. Relationship 
with Teresa Ann GOATHAM Born Abt 1729 - From Alumni Oxonienses which shows him as aged 18 when he matriculated in 1747, and from age at death in burial register(transcribed data by DFHS from BTs shows aged 68)
Also shown as son of Peter of Bideford
Baptised 6 Mar 1728/29 St. Mary’s Church, Bideford, Devon, England
- From PR entry (image on FMP, viewed 27 Feb 2017)
Gender Male Education Bef 1753 Exeter College, Oxford University, Oxford, Oxfordshire, England
Ordained 18 Mar 1753 Chapel Royal, The Banqueting House, Whitehall, London, England
Priest - Ordained by Richard Trevor, Bishop of Durham, authorised by Benjamin Hoadly, Bishop of Winchester.
Occupation From 26 Nov 1754 Chaplain to Harry, Duke of Bolton - From CCEd website
Occupation From 22 Feb 1758 to 1797 Bicton, Devon, England
Rector - From burial record where shown as Rector of the Parish for 39 years and date of institution that he gave in his Episcopal Visitation Return of 1779. This return gives an idea of his work - not onerous, with only about 20 families in the parish.
Died Abt 1797 - From date of probate of his will (PCC)
Buried 10 Mar 1797 Holy Trinity Church, Bicton, Devon, England
- From PR entry (image on FMP, viewed 15 Sep 2020)
"[1797] March 10th. Revd. John Glubb 39 Years Rector of this Parish aged 68 Years he was buried at the South Side of the Communion Table"
